Abstract(in English) | Ring networks that employ WDM technologies will be a key application among various transport network applications to support future high-speed multi-media services. This paper categorizes WDM ring networks as per the optical channel schemes and ring architectures such as uni-directional/bi-directional and 2-fiber/4-fiber ring. The protection architecture and network supervisioning capability are taken into consideration for comparison among different types of ring. The multiple fiber ring architectures and their node architecture are also presented. Finally application range for each type of ring are presented. |
